An engineer wants to assess the relationship between sintering time and the compressive strength of three different metals. The engineer measures the compressive strength of five specimens of each metal type at each sintering time: 100 minutes, 150 minutes, and 200 minutes. The engineer has set her alpha level at 0.05. Minitab returns the results in Table 4.3 from an analysis of her experiment. Interpret the results and determine what subsequent analysis you would carry out. (4 marks) Table 4.3: Minitab Output from Sintering of Metal Types Experiment Analysis of Variance DF Adj SS Source Adj MS F-Value P-Value 1.71 0.2094 SinterTime 2 8.222 4.1111 20.222 0.0318 MetalType 2 10.1111 4.20 46.222 11.5556 4.80 0.0082 SinterTime*MetalType 4 43.333 18 2.4074 Error 118.000 Total 26
